Output 17a56d82fc933a0d967004a939724925e9b7bfa037adb13fc796906294c1a9e9:0

value
66864601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387dd66ca4591026a313c7a7efafdbdc8afb1fe0 OP_EQUAL
address
MD3rpXEZkWCP5zWornxPrx3Bn6X4bvzEdC
transaction
17a56d82fc933a0d967004a939724925e9b7bfa037adb13fc796906294c1a9e9
spent
true